AI Summary

  • Creates a legislative committee composed of members from the House Resources and Conservation Committee and Senate Resources and Environment Committee to study expenditure of American Rescue Plan Act (ARPA) funds for water infrastructure.

  • Idaho's estimated share of ARPA federal funding through the Coronavirus State Fiscal Recovery Fund is $1.19 billion, available until December 31, 2024.

  • Committee voting requires separate votes from House and Senate members, with a majority of each chamber required to approve any motion before the full committee.

  • Committee is authorized to receive input, advice, and assistance from interested and affected parties who are not members of the Legislature.

  • Committee must report its findings, recommendations, and any proposed legislation to the Second Regular Session of the Sixty-sixth Idaho Legislature.

Legislative Description

States findings of the Legislature and creates a legislative interim study committee to study and make recommendations regarding the expenditure of federal funds received for water infrastructure purposes under the American Rescue Plan Act of 2021.
